Looks like The Ellen Show might be coming to an end! An insider is claiming that Ellen sees walking away as the only way to clear her name! However, they claim that might now fix the damage…
Looks like The Ellen Show might be coming to an end! An insider is claiming that Ellen sees walking away as the only way to clear her name! However, they claim that might now fix the damage…